RESULT: Drugs suspect finally on the move

 
12/05/2018 @ 09:24

A man suspected of hiding drugs up his bum during a police raid has finally had a ‘movement’.

In what is believed to be a first for Dyfed-Powys, officers used a S152 Criminal Justice Act to detain persons suspected of concealing drugs. The man was  man one of three arrested by offficers in Welshpool on May 1. He was charged with an offence of possession with intent to supply. But the waiting game for evidence took a lot longer than expected. 

A quantity of drugs was recovered following address searches, and the other two men were released under investigation. 

Yesterday PS Tom Marshall said: “He is under constant watch and will remain with us until any drugs have been passed.”

Tonight he tweeted:"Day 12. Boom. There has been a movement, suspected Class A drugs passed by detainee.
